2027: DEPUTY SPEAKER URGES NDI IGBO TO REGIATER FOR ELECTIONS

By: Safiya Abdulrahim DABBAN

Deputy Speaker of the House of Representatives, Dr. Benjamin Kalu, has called on the people of the South East to take part in the ongoing Continuous Voter Registration (CVR) by INEC.

He expressed concern over the low turnout in the region, stressing that voter registration is the first step to having a voice in governance and shaping election outcomes.

Dr. Kalu urged Ndi Igbo to seize the opportunity, register in large numbers, and strengthen their political influence ahead of 2027.

“If we want development, we must be part of decision-making. It starts with registering to vote,” he said.
